Tim Hortons and Burger King Finalize a Merger
:Prince George, B.C.- It's a deal.
Tim Hortons and Burger King have announced they have reached an agreement to merge and "create a new global powerhouse in the quick service restaurant sector."
The merger will create a single company that will have about $23 billion dollars in system sales and more than 18 thousand arestaurants in 100 countries. The new company will be based in Canada.
In a news release issued today, the company says the merger has been "unanimously approved by the Board of Directors of both companies". Tim Hortons shareholders will receive $65.50 (Candian Dollars) in cash and 0.8025 common shares of the new company per Tim Hortons share.
Marc Caira, President and CEO of Tim Hortons offeres an assurance that Tim's will not change “We are very proud of the great history of our organization and the progress we have achieved in creating value and delivering the ultimate experience for our guests. As an independent brand within the new company, this transaction will enable us to move more quickly and efficiently to bring Tim Hortons iconic Canadian brand to a new global customer base. At the same time, our customers, employees, franchisees and fellow Canadians can all rest assured that Tim Hortons will still be Tim Hortons following this transaction, including our core values, employee and franchisee relationships, community support and fresh coffee.”
